Chimney inspection services involve a thorough assessment of a chimney’s condition to identify potential issues that could affect safety, efficiency, or functionality. Professionals typically examine the exterior and interior components, including the chimney crown, flue, damper, and masonry. Using specialized tools, inspectors look for signs of damage, blockages, creosote buildup, or structural deterioration. This process helps property owners understand the current state of their chimney and determine if repairs or cleaning are necessary to maintain proper operation.
The primary problems addressed through chimney inspections include the detection of creosote accumulation, which can increase the risk of fires, as well as cracks, leaks, or deterioration that may lead to water damage or structural failure. Inspections can also reveal obstructions such as bird nests or debris that could prevent proper venting of smoke and gases. By identifying these issues early, property owners can prevent costly repairs, improve safety, and ensure their chimney functions efficiently during use.

Inspection Costs - The typical cost for a chimney inspection ranges from $100 to $300, depending on the level of assessment required. For example, a basic visual inspection might cost around $100, while a more detailed assessment could be closer to $300.
Service Charges - Service fees for chimney inspection services usually fall between $150 and $400. This range accounts for additional services such as minor repairs or detailed reports, with prices varying by location and provider.
Additional Expenses - Some service providers may charge extra for specialized inspections or in-depth assessments, which can add $50 to $200 to the overall cost. Costs may also vary based on chimney height and accessibility.
Cost Factors - The final cost for chimney inspection services can fluctuate based on factors like chimney size, condition, and the complexity of the inspection. Local pros typically provide estimates after evaluating the specific needs of the chimney.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Visual Chimney Inspection focuses on a thorough visual assessment of the chimney exterior and interior to detect cracks, blockages, or damage that may require attention from a qualified service provider.
Video Chimney Inspection utilizes camera technology to inspect hard-to-reach areas within the chimney flue, helping identify obstructions or deterioration that might not be visible during a standard inspection.
Chimney Flue Inspection involves examining the flue liner for cracks, creosote buildup, or other issues that could impact venting safety, with local pros providing necessary evaluations.

What is involved in a chimney inspection? A chimney inspection typically includes examining the interior and exterior of the chimney for damage, blockages, and creosote buildup to ensure safe operation.
How often should a chimney be inspected? It is recommended to have a chimney inspected annually, especially if the fireplace is used frequently or after severe weather events.
What are the signs that a chimney needs inspection or repair? Signs include smoke backup, unpleasant odors, visible creosote buildup, cracks, or damaged mortar joints.
What types of chimney inspections are available? There are different levels of inspections, ranging from visual exterior checks to comprehensive interior examinations using specialized tools.
